If you suffered through a recent heat wave at your desk while the computer churned out even more heat, you can appreciate the U.S.B. Beverage Chiller from CoolIT Systems.

The people behind this device point out that chilling an entire can of soda or other refreshing drink is not the idea. What they want to do is keep the last third or so of the drink cold. The part that, when you come back to it, is lukewarm and therefore not that drinkable.
